Primary Health Care Information System for Community Health Centres
22 March 2006
SOURCE: Department of Health (Provincial Government of the Western Cape)
The Western Cape Provincial Department of Health has launched a Primary Health Care Information System at 13 Community Health Centres in the province. This system allocates each patient with a unique number, which can be used universally throughout health facilities.

"The patient information system infrastructure allows for operability in admissions discharge and transfers, appointment scheduling and maintaining of full patient records," said Pierre Uys, Minister for Health in the Western Cape.

The need for a single provincial database accessible by all patient-based systems prompted for a mandate to be issued for an investigation into a primary health care information system.

The implemented system would be managed in various stages. These stages include:

  • The provision of network infrastructure and hardware to selected CHC's in the province.
  • The implementation of the PHCIS at 13 CHC's.
  • The development and implementation of the ART software at three pilot sites.
  • The expansion of the ART software to provide functionality to record all chronic disease encounters as well as acute and preventive encounters.
  • The rollout of the full PHCIS to all infrastructure-ready CHCs.

The benefits of implementing the PHCIS at nine 24-hour facilities and four eight-hour facilities include:

  1. Coordinated and streamlined patient administration.
  2. Minimal duplication of patient information.
  3. Access to individual electronic patient records (EPR) via a unique patient number.
  4. Provision of an automated and more reliable headcount statistics.
  5. Improved service to patients.
  6. Reduced waiting times and time for patient admission.
  7. Improved communication between facilities.
  8. Improve patient flow.
  9. Easier locations of patient medical records regardless of where they were previously registered.

Sites and Dates of PHCIS rollout to CHC's

19th March - Mitchell's Plain and Gugulethu
26 March - Khayelitsha - Site B, Nolungile and Micheal Mapongwana
2nd April - Retreat and Hanover Park
9th April - Heideveld and Vanguard
23rd April - Macassar and Kraaifontein
30th April - Delft and Elsies CHC
